2014 WST to ETB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2014

During 2014, the WST to ETB ex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on July 13, valuing the pair at 8.6835.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on February 5, dropping to 8.1323.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.5512 ETB.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 8.2229 to the December average rate of 8.4001, the exchange rate registered a net change of 2.15%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2014 high of 8.6835 was up 4.45% compared to the 2013 peak of 8.3137,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

WST to ETB Seasonal Trends & Volatility Analysis

A structured review of seasonal halves, trading extremes, consecutive streaks, and historical baselines.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 8.3777, compared to 8.4748 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the second half (Jul–Dec) by a margin of 0.0971 points.

H1 Avg (Jan–Jun) 8.3777
H2 Avg (Jul–Dec) 8.4748

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2014 was September, with a trading range of 0.3057 ETB (High: 8.6311 / Low: 8.3254). On the other end, December was the most stable month, with a tight range of 0.0617 ETB (High: 8.4283 / Low: 8.3666).

September Spread (Volatile) ±0.3057
December Spread (Stable) ±0.0617

Growth Streaks & Declines

Trends

Between January and May, the exchange rate recorded its longest consecutive growth streak of the year, climbing for 4 straight months. Conversely, the sharpest month-over-month decline occurred between September and October, when the average rate fell by 0.0915 points.

Longest Streak 4 Mo.
Sharpest MoM Drop -0.0915

Same-Month Historical Baseline

YoY Baseline

Comparing the current year's strongest month average (July 2014: 8.5907) against the same month in 2013 (average: 7.9941), the exchange rate shifted by +0.5966 (+7.46%).

2014 Avg (July) 8.5907
2013 Avg (July) 7.9941
